How much do lighthouse attendant j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 5, 2026, the average hourly pay for lighthouse attendant in the United States is $15.45,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$13.46 and $17.07 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What qualifications do I need to be a lighthouse attendant?

Lighthouse attendants typically need a high school diploma or equivalent and may require experience in maritime operations, navigation, or maintenance. Good communication skills, attention to detail, and the ability to work in isolated or outdoor environments are important; some positions may also require certifications in first aid or safety procedures.
